The Organization of American States is the world’s oldest regional organization, dating back to the First International Conference of American States, held in Washington, D.C., from October 1889 to April 1890. That meeting approved the establishment of the International Union of American Republics, and the stage was set for the weaving of a web of provisions and institutions that came to be known as the inter-American system, the oldest international institutional system.

  • Scholarship Award: Alma College shall waive USD 36,000 (90%) of the tuition fee per year for the duration of the program of study for the top three (3) awardees and the OAS shall provide a one-time tuition allowance of USD 2,500 to the top three (3) awardees who receive the 90% tuition waiver from Alma College during the first year of study.
  • Alma College shall waive USD 30,000 (75%) of the tuition fee per year for the duration of the program of study for the remaining awardees and the OAS shall provide a one-time tuition allowance of USD $4,000 to top seven (7) awardees who receive the 75% tuition waiver from Alma College during the first year of study.
  • Alma College shall waive USD 30,000 (75%) of the tuition fee per year for the duration of the program of study for the remaining awardees.
